Output afafec3f84ce7900619dbf0c0e9ea8f8806b75ae1d2e1083b7e4380b34d36cd2:20

value
1648046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e988e4c7c21e55495301573b4ad1a2ce723c3a49 OP_EQUAL
address
3NyqMnA8xgM8KdFLqnY96xLMaRCipoSt2E
transaction
afafec3f84ce7900619dbf0c0e9ea8f8806b75ae1d2e1083b7e4380b34d36cd2
confirmations
366790
spent
true